Israel Expands Gaza Offensive, Kills Hamas Commander in Lebanon
The Israeli Defense Forces (IDF) have intensified their military operations in Gaza, specifically targeting the Shejaiya neighborhood, while also conducting a significant airstrike in Lebanon that killed Hassan Farhat, a senior Hamas commander. This operation aims to strengthen Israel's security buffer and dismantle remaining Hamas infrastructure, with recent airstrikes in Gaza resulting in the deaths of several Hamas operatives. The IDF has facilitated civilian evacuations from the conflict zones, although the situation remains dire, with many Palestinians fleeing amid escalating violence. Concurrently, the airstrike in Sidon has drawn condemnation from Lebanese officials, who regard it as a violation of sovereignty and a breach of the ceasefire established in November. The renewed hostilities follow the collapse of negotiations for a ceasefire, with both sides sustaining significant casualties. Israeli officials maintain that these actions are necessary to address ongoing security threats posed by Hamas and other militant groups.
